Output d393318f8aa85a584e4fe156606c42f451c3ce3956fa98afd961102bbba7974d:2

value
9249183896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c379fd6bbc7c65dc6325d5c7282c74df859c9e2 OP_EQUAL
address
MBvxbihRzJm2mGujfzwVXq6ZoEWfmGc6Bx
transaction
d393318f8aa85a584e4fe156606c42f451c3ce3956fa98afd961102bbba7974d
spent
true